About Raising The Village

At Raising The Village (RTV), we are dedicated to eradicating ultra-poverty in Sub-Saharan Africa. As a dynamic, rapidly growing international development organization, we’ve assembled a team of over 350+ passionate individuals in Uganda, Rwanda, Tanzania and DRC, alongside an additional 10+ professionals in North America. Together, we are committed to elevating communities out of ultra-poverty by implementing innovative solutions and leveraging advanced data analytics to drive impact.

To date, our holistic approach has positively impacted over 1,000,000 lives since 2012, and we’re poised to achieve even greater milestones, aiming to assist 1 million individuals annually by 2027. Role Overview

Reporting to the Project Manager, the Project Officer will work to support Raising The Village (RTV) programs in Rwanda and oversee RTV’s Project Assistants in all aspects of their work. They are responsible to ensure follow up and follow through as per project designs and workplans. An RTV Project Officer is the first point of contact to resolve issues and find solutions to challenges experienced by Projects Assistants in the field as well as in the office. The ideal candidate is well-versed in processes under their roles responsibilities, is results-driven and focused with a clear goal of ensuring that implementation work is carried out on time, within budget and results in sustainable quality work.

Given RTV’s government-partnership implementation model, the Project Officer must demonstrate strong experience working closely with local government institutions, particularly at Sector and Cell levels, to ensure alignment, coordination, and smooth program delivery.

This role is highly field-based and requires extensive travel (approximately 80% of the time), including frequent visits to remote rural communities.

Government Coordination, Capacity Building & Partnership Management

• Coordinate with Sector- and Cell-level government officials to support RTV project implementation in line with agreed partnership frameworks and local government priorities.

• Plan, coordinate, and facilitate trainings for government staff (e.g. Sector Agronomists, SEDOs, Cell ESs) on RTV methodologies, roles, and implementation processes

• Jointly mobilize communities with government counterparts and RTV staff to ensure clear messaging, strong community ownership, maximized adoption of RTV program components, and high attendance and active participation in all community-level trainings

• Provide ongoing coaching and on-the-job support to government staff involved in RTV activities to strengthen coordination, accountability, and implementation quality

• Support government counterparts in supervision and monitoring of RTV-supported activities, including joint field visits, household coaching sessions, and problem-solving at community

• level

• Collect, validate, and consolidate activity and progress reports from government counterparts and ensure timely integration into RTV reporting systems.

• Promote a strong partnership culture between government officials and RTV staff to ensure smooth, effective, and sustainable implementation of RTV projects at sector level

What you need to know about the Chicago Tech Scene

With vibrant neighborhoods, great food and more affordable housing than either coast, Chicago might be the most liveable major tech hub. It is the birthplace of modern commodities and futures trading, a national hub for logistics and commerce, and home to the American Medical Association and the American Bar Association. This diverse blend of industry influences has helped Chicago emerge as a major player in verticals like fintech, biotechnology, legal tech, e-commerce and logistics technology. It’s also a major hiring center for tech companies on both coasts.

Key Facts About Chicago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 245,800; 5.2%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: McDonald’s, John Deere, Boeing, Morningstar
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, fintech, software, logistics technology
  • Funding Landscape: $2.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Pritzker Group Venture Capital, Arch Venture Partners, MATH Venture Partners, Jump Capital, Hyde Park Venture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: Northwestern University, University of Chicago, University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ign, Illinois Institute of Technology, Argonne National Laboratory, Fermi National Accelerator Laboratory
